Located in the Central Anatolia Region, Kırıkkale is surrounded by Çorum and Yozgat in the east, Kırşehir in the south, Ankara in the west and Çankırı in the north.

 

Altitude 700 m

Longitude 33o 10'-34 o 13' East    

Latitude 39 o 23' -40 o 21'  North  

Surface Area 4,630 km2    

Districts: Central, Bahşili, Balışeyh, Çelebi, Delice, Karakeçili, Keskin, Sulakyurt, Yahşihan    

Statistical Region (İBBS Level II, III) TR71, TR711    

 

Distance to Some Metropolitan Cities

Ankara: 75 km.

İstanbul   : 530 km.

Konya     : 270 km.

Kayseri    : 245 km.  

 

Transportation

 

1.Highway Network    

Kırıkkale is 76 km away from Ankara, and 60 km away from Ankara ring road connection. With the putting of the Elmadağ viaduct into service, the journey time has decreased, comfort and safety have increased. Ankara opens to 43 provinces on its east side through Kırıkkale by a divided highway.

With the completed Karakeçili-Kulu connection, access to the E-90 highway and the southern provinces, and with the Kalecik connection, access to the E-80 highway and the northern provinces is provided faster and more comfortably. The completion of the 432 km long Ankara-Kırıkkale-Samsun Highway will take the logistics advantages of Kırıkkale to a higher level.  

2. Airway Transportation

Located 90 km from Esenboğa Airport, which has direct flights to 43 international and 30 domestic destinations, Kırıkkale has the similar advantage as Başkent Ankara in terms of air transportation. 

3. Railway Transportation

There are two main railway line routes in Kırıkkale; the length of the railway network passing through the borders of Ankara-Kırıkkale-Kayseri-Sivas-Kars Ankara-Kırıkkale-Çankırı-Zonguldak Provinces is 97 km and there are 4 stations. The passenger trains, and the freight trains with 16 departure and 16 arrival run every day. In addition, there is RAYBUS transportation between Ankara and Kırıkkale 4 times a day (2 departures-2 arrivals). Ankara-Sivas high-speed train line, which is still under construction, passes through Kırıkkale. As the high speed train project once completed, Kırıkkale will get closer to Ankara.
